When she was born, she has a Torticollis, or wry neck, a condition in which the head is tilted toward one side. I only realized that when she was 4 month old. From thereon, we sent her for physiotheraphy for at least 4 months. It was very hearthbreaking everytime i send her for therapy. Her scream is unbearable everytime her chiropractor pull and stretch her neck at the other side. They gave us some exercises to do at home which include literally stretching her neck in the opposite direction and also placing soft toys to the side she tilts so that she will turn her head in that direction.

Overtime... at the age of 2, she manage to outgrow with it and now looking perfectly alright.
